The Training Grounds Terms and Conditions - Trainers

These Trainer Terms and Conditions (“Trainer Terms”) apply to all trainers, coaches, and fitness professionals (“Trainers”) who offer services through The Training Grounds (“TTG”).

By listing availability, accepting bookings, or delivering sessions through TTG, you confirm that you have read, understood, and agree to these Trainer Terms.

1.0 The Training Grounds’ role

The Training Grounds operates a platform and marketplace that connects clients with independent Trainers. TTG provides booking, scheduling, payment, and support tools.

Unless expressly stated otherwise in writing, TTG:

  • Is not the training provider,

  • Is not a gym or medical service, and

  • Does not supervise day‑to‑day coaching delivery.

Each training session is a direct service relationship between you and the client, subject to these Trainer Terms and the End User Terms.

4.0 Attendance and punctuality

4.1.0 Mandatory attendance

You are required to attend every confirmed session at the agreed time, date, and location (or online platform).

4.2.0 Punctuality

You must be:

  • Ready to coach at the scheduled start time, and

  • Appropriately prepared (equipment, plan, environment).

Late arrival without prior notice is considered a service failure.

4.3.0 No‑shows

A Trainer no‑show occurs if you:

  • Do not attend the session, or

  • Are not contactable within 10 minutes of the scheduled start time, without prior notice.

Trainer no‑shows are treated seriously and may result in reviews, penalties, or removal from the platform.

6.0 Cancellations, availability changes, and refunds

6.1.0 Trainer‑initiated cancellations

If you become unavailable for a booked session, you must:

  • Notify the client as soon as reasonably possible, and

  • Notify TTG where required.

6.2.0 Client options

When a Trainer cancels, the client must be offered:

  • A rescheduled session at no additional cost, or

  • A full refund.

6.3.0 Refund responsibility

Where a Trainer cancellation or no‑show occurs, you agree that:

  • The client is entitled to a full refund, and

  • TTG may process the refund on your behalf and recover the amount from future payouts if applicable.

Repeated cancellations may lead to suspension or termination of your Trainer account.
